Diagnosing the Problem
To help your pet feel better, we must first determine precisely what’s causing the problem. We may be able to tell what’s wrong through a cursory exam, or we may need to investigate further. Blood work, skin scrapings and biopsies can provide answers we need to move forward with a cure.
Some dermatological issues we routinely assist with include:
- Allergies (food and/or environmental)
- Infections (acute or chronic)
- Parasites
- Dermatitis
- Hormonal disorders
- Autoimmune diseases
- Tumors
- Skin cancer
Developing a Treatment Plan
Once we’ve identified the problem, the next step is determining how to best treat it. Depending on the situation, we may recommend something as simple as applying a topical medication. More complex conditions may call for a longer-term strategy or involve a combination of multiple treatment methods.
Signs of a possible skin problem include:
- Excessive scratching
- Scabbing or flaking of the skin
- Hot spots
- Shedding more than usual
- Biting, chewing or licking at the affected area
- Bumps or lumps on or under the skin
